After updating the browser to Opera One (version: 133.0.5932.85), upon startup, a page with the information “Update completed” “What’s new in Opera” constantly opens.<br />
How to fix this?</p>

<p dir="auto">You can close Opera and delete the "Sessions" folder in "C:\Users\yourusername\AppData\Roaming\Opera Software\Opera Stable\Default" to see if it helps. You'll lose all open tabs though.</p>
<p dir="auto">While Opera is closed, you can delete everything in "C:\Windows\temp" and "C:\Users\yourusername\AppData\Local\temp" to see if it helps.</p>
<p dir="auto">You can uninstall Opera (don't choose to delete your data when asked), delete the "Opera" install folder in "C:\Users\yourusername\AppData\Local\Programs" that remains, clear those 2 temp folders, download the Opera installer in whatever browser you want, launch it, click "options", adjust everything how you want and reinstall. That might fix it. Not sure as I don't have the issue.</p>
